Preadministration of Lorazepam Reduces Efficacy and Longevity of Antidepressant-Like Effect from a Psychedelic.

Psychedelic medicine (New Rochelle, N.Y.) – March 01, 2024

Summary

Psychedelics like psilocybin show promise in treating depression, but their effectiveness can be influenced by other medications. In a study with rats, preadministration of lorazepam diminished the long-lasting antidepressant efficacy of psilocin. While psilocin boosted activity initially, lorazepam reduced its benefits over time.
